Job Description
What We Offer Novant Health Sports Medicine is hiring a full-time Athletic Trainer to join their team! This role will support the athletic program at Oak Grove High School in Winston-Salem, NC. At Novant Health, Athletic Trainers must be licensed in the appropriate state, will act under the supervision of a physician and must adhere to the Protocols and guidelines as required by the licensing agency. The protocols must be written in collaboration with the supervising physician and reviewed annually. The Athletic Trainer works in the areas of primary care, sports medicine or orthopedic clinical setting, specializing in the delivery of high quality health care for those engaged in physical activity. They also promote Novant Health and the practice through outreach and education for health and wellness in the community.
